From 62804195f8ad6cad80db11b526ed8a2924bf41e4 Mon Sep 17 00:00:00 2001 From: Marcus Mellor Date: Thu, 29 Feb 2024 11:22:40 -0600 Subject: [PATCH] soc: organize SoC sources --- .gitmodules | 2 +- soc/README.md | 1 + soc/{ => src}/ahbxuiconverter.sv | 2 +- soc/{ => src}/basejump_stl | 0 soc/{ => src}/bsg_dmc_ahb.sv | 2 +- soc/{ => src}/fifo/fifo.sv | 0 soc/{ => src}/fifo/fifomem.sv | 0 soc/{ => src}/fifo/rptr_empty.sv | 0 soc/{ => src}/fifo/sync_r2w.sv | 0 soc/{ => src}/fifo/sync_w2r.sv | 0 soc/{ => src}/fifo/wptr_full.sv | 0 11 files changed, 4 insertions(+), 3 deletions(-) create mode 100644 soc/README.md rename soc/{ => src}/ahbxuiconverter.sv (98%) rename soc/{ => src}/basejump_stl (100%) rename soc/{ => src}/bsg_dmc_ahb.sv (99%) rename soc/{ => src}/fifo/fifo.sv (100%) rename soc/{ => src}/fifo/fifomem.sv (100%) rename soc/{ => src}/fifo/rptr_empty.sv (100%) rename soc/{ => src}/fifo/sync_r2w.sv (100%) rename soc/{ => src}/fifo/sync_w2r.sv (100%) rename soc/{ => src}/fifo/wptr_full.sv (100%) diff --git a/.gitmodules b/.gitmodules index da4ce37c1..844387a0f 100644 --- a/.gitmodules +++ b/.gitmodules @@ -30,5 +30,5 @@ path = addins/ahbsdc url = http://github.com/JacobPease/ahbsdc.git [submodule "src/uncore/basejump_stl"] - path = soc/basejump_stl + path = soc/src/basejump_stl url = https://github.com/bespoke-silicon-group/basejump_stl diff --git a/soc/README.md b/soc/README.md new file mode 100644 index 000000000..0868cb748 --- /dev/null +++ b/soc/README.md @@ -0,0 +1 @@ +This folder contains resources related to the Wally SoC effort. diff --git a/soc/ahbxuiconverter.sv b/soc/src/ahbxuiconverter.sv similarity index 98% rename from soc/ahbxuiconverter.sv rename to soc/src/ahbxuiconverter.sv index cb607889b..2d672a796 100644 --- a/soc/ahbxuiconverter.sv +++ b/soc/src/ahbxuiconverter.sv @@ -1,7 +1,7 @@ /////////////////////////////////////////// // ahbxuiconverter.sv // -// Written: infinitymdm@gmail.com +// Written: infinitymdm@gmail.com 29 February 2024 // // Purpose: AHB to Xilinx UI converter // diff --git a/soc/basejump_stl b/soc/src/basejump_stl similarity index 100% rename from soc/basejump_stl rename to soc/src/basejump_stl diff --git a/soc/bsg_dmc_ahb.sv b/soc/src/bsg_dmc_ahb.sv similarity index 99% rename from soc/bsg_dmc_ahb.sv rename to soc/src/bsg_dmc_ahb.sv index 83de36b86..875e7b99c 100644 --- a/soc/bsg_dmc_ahb.sv +++ b/soc/src/bsg_dmc_ahb.sv @@ -1,7 +1,7 @@ /////////////////////////////////////////// // bsg_dmc_ahb.sv // -// Written: infinitymdm@gmail.com +// Written: infinitymdm@gmail.com 29 February 2024 // // Purpose: BSG controller and LPDDRDRAM presenting an AHB interface // diff --git a/soc/fifo/fifo.sv b/soc/src/fifo/fifo.sv similarity index 100% rename from soc/fifo/fifo.sv rename to soc/src/fifo/fifo.sv diff --git a/soc/fifo/fifomem.sv b/soc/src/fifo/fifomem.sv similarity index 100% rename from soc/fifo/fifomem.sv rename to soc/src/fifo/fifomem.sv diff --git a/soc/fifo/rptr_empty.sv b/soc/src/fifo/rptr_empty.sv similarity index 100% rename from soc/fifo/rptr_empty.sv rename to soc/src/fifo/rptr_empty.sv diff --git a/soc/fifo/sync_r2w.sv b/soc/src/fifo/sync_r2w.sv similarity index 100% rename from soc/fifo/sync_r2w.sv rename to soc/src/fifo/sync_r2w.sv diff --git a/soc/fifo/sync_w2r.sv b/soc/src/fifo/sync_w2r.sv similarity index 100% rename from soc/fifo/sync_w2r.sv rename to soc/src/fifo/sync_w2r.sv diff --git a/soc/fifo/wptr_full.sv b/soc/src/fifo/wptr_full.sv similarity index 100% rename from soc/fifo/wptr_full.sv rename to soc/src/fifo/wptr_full.sv